Off-Flavor Removal from Sheep Placenta via Fermentation with Novel Yeast Strain <i>Brettanomyces deamine</i> kh3 Isolated from Traditional Apple Vinegar

Animal placentae can be used as health-promoting food ingredients with various therapeutic efficacies, but their use is limited by their unpleasant odor and taste.
